Emirates Collaborates with Crypto.com to Introduce Crypto Payments in Travel
Emirates, one of the world’s leading airlines, has recently announced a partnership with Crypto.com to introduce cryptocurrency payments in the travel industry. The collaboration aims to cater to the increasing demand from customers for digital asset options when making travel bookings and transactions.
The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) between Emirates and Crypto.com was signed in Dubai, with Sheikh Ahmed bin Saeed Al Maktoum, Chairman and CEO of Emirates Airline & Group, overseeing the agreement. Adnan Kazim, Emirates’ Deputy President and Chief Commercial Officer, and Mohammed Al Hakim, President of Crypto.com’s UAE operations, formalized the partnership.
Emirates expressed that integrating digital payments into its services aligns with its digital strategy and commitment to providing flexible payment options for its customers. This move follows Emirates’ earlier interest in crypto payments, with plans to accept Bitcoin (BTC) being discussed as early as 2022, after the UAE introduced crypto-friendly regulations.
Adnan Kazim, Deputy President and Chief Commercial Officer of Emirates, highlighted the airline’s recognition of the growing demand for crypto payments, especially among tech-savvy travelers. He emphasized that partnering with Crypto.com to integrate cryptocurrency into their payment system reflects Emirates’ dedication to meeting evolving customer preferences.
Eric Anziani, President and COO of Crypto.com, shared his excitement about the partnership, stating that it signifies a significant step towards expanding real-world use cases for crypto payments. He believes that this collaboration will drive momentum for the digital asset industry as a whole.
The implementation of crypto payments through Crypto.com Pay is expected to launch next year, pending internal readiness and regulatory approvals. Both Emirates and Crypto.com plan to leverage promotional marketing campaigns to raise awareness and encourage the adoption of this new payment solution among customers.
If successful, Emirates will become one of the first major international airlines to fully integrate cryptocurrency into its payment stack, setting a new standard for the travel industry.
